Abstract
We present a method of hydrodynamic analysis of a two-layer porous bearing of finite length and evaluate the influence of the ratio of the characteristic permeabilities of the layers on the basic characteristics of the bearing. It is established that, in comparison with the two-layer porous bearing of constant thickness, the layered bearing with variable thickness of the outer layer has twice the load capacity.
